  • Patent number: 11876808
    Abstract: A method, system, and computer-implemented method to manage threats to a protected network having a plurality of internal production systems is provided. The method includes monitoring network traffic from the plurality of internal production systems of a protected network for domain names. For each internal production system, a first collection of each unique domain name that is output by the internal production system is determined over the course of a long time interval. For each internal production system, a second collection of each unique domain name that is output by the internal production system is determined over the course of a short time interval. Domain names in the first and second collections associated with the plurality of internal production systems are compared to determine suspicious domain names that meet a predetermined condition. A request is output to treat the suspicious the suspicious domain names as being suspicious.

  • Patent number: 11356415
    Abstract: A method and system for detecting impersonated network traffic by a protected computing device and a network protection system. The method includes the computing device receiving installation of a browser application, the browser application configured to generate requests to communicate with other computers via the World Wide Web and receiving a configuration for the browser application. The browser application is configured to obtain a short-lived password (SLP) in coordination with generating a request and insert the short-lived password into the generated request before transmitting the request. The SLP is synchronized with an expected value generated by the network protection system. The transmitted request is passed to the network protection system and treated as legitimate network traffic by the network protection system only if the network protection system detects and verifies the SLP.

  • Patent number: 8918863
    Abstract: Method and apparatus for monitoring source data that is a target of a backup service is described. In one example, backup data produced by the backup service is analyzed to identify changes in the source data. At least one trend related to the changes is identified. At least one deviation in the changes from the at least one trend is identified. At least one notification may then be generated that includes information indicative of the at least one deviation. The notification(s) may be sent to a network management system as an indication of user error or malicious attacks.
